Monsters: Dark Continent (2014)

Monsters: Dark Continent is the 2014 sequel to 2010's Monsters. Directed by Tom Green, the sequel is set ten years after the original film and follows some US Army soldiers who are in the Middle East fighting for their lives against the advanced alien warriors.


The following weapons were used in the film Monsters: Dark Continent:

FN M249 SAW

A soldier is seen carrying a first-pattern FN M249 SAW with a Para buttstock.

Error creating thumbnail: File missing
M249 (first pattern U.S. adopted variant of the original FN Minimi) - 5.56x45mm. The only noticeable change from the Belgian Minimi is the rear sight design and cut outs in the buttstock. Other minor changes would result in the M249-E1 and the M249-E2.
